The 2002 Porsche 911 Turbo is generally considered a reliable vehicle, but like any high-performance car, it can experience specific issues. Common problems reported include oil leaks, turbocharger failures, and electrical quirks, often related to age and wear. Routine maintenance and proper care can mitigate many of these issues, but potential buyers should have a thorough pre-purchase inspection. Overall, while not without potential problems, many owners find them to be dependable sports cars when well-maintained.
